Add 8/12 and 3/10
8/12 + 3/10 is 29/30.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 12 and 10 is 60
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 60 - For the 1st fraction, since 12 × 5 = 60,
8/12 = 8 × 5/12 × 5 = 40/60 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 10 × 6 = 60,
3/10 = 3 × 6/10 × 6 = 18/60 - Add the two like fractions:
40/60 + 18/60 = 40 + 18/60 = 58/60 - 58/60 simplified gives 29/30
- So, 8/12 + 3/10 = 29/30
